Etymology[edit]
From Ancient Greek μέγας (mégas, “large”) + ὄνυξ (ónux, “claw”).
Proper noun[edit]
Megalonyx m
- A taxonomic genus within the family Megalonychidae – extinct ground sloths from the Pleistocene of North America.
